会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
手可摘星辰。
博客园
首页
新随笔
联系
订阅
管理
上一页
1
···
14
15
16
17
18
19
20
21
22
···
26
下一页
2019年12月10日
python_面向对象——动态创建类和isinstance和issubclass方法
摘要: # 给动态生产的类定义一个方法 def __init__(self,name): self.name = name print(self.name) def take(self,obj): print(obj) # 动态生成一个类type('类名',(父类1,父类2,),{字典:属性或方法}) Do
阅读全文
posted @ 2019-12-10 22:46 手可摘星辰。
阅读(168)
评论(0)
推荐(0)
2019年12月8日
python_面向对象——双下划线方法
摘要: 1.__str__和__repe__ class Person(object): def __init__(self,name,age): self.name = name self.age = age def __str__(self): return 'stf:我叫{},今年{}岁'.forma
阅读全文
posted @ 2019-12-08 21:06 手可摘星辰。
阅读(610)
评论(0)
推荐(0)
2019年12月7日
python_反射:应用
摘要: class User(object): def denglu(self): print('欢迎来到登录页面!') def zhuce(self): print('欢迎来到注册页面!') def youke(self): print('欢迎来到游客页面!') u = User() while True
阅读全文
posted @ 2019-12-07 22:38 手可摘星辰。
阅读(135)
评论(0)
推荐(0)
python_反射——根据字符串获取模块中的属性
摘要: 1.获取当前模块中的属性 class Person(object): def __init__(self,name,age): self.name = name self.age = age p = Person('wdc',22) import sys q = sys.modules[__name
阅读全文
posted @ 2019-12-07 17:04 手可摘星辰。
阅读(928)
评论(0)
推荐(1)
2019年12月4日
python_面向对象——反射
摘要: 1.反射 四个方法:getattr() 获取 class Person(): def __init__(self,name,age): self.name = name self.age = age p = Person('wdc',22) a = getattr(p,'name') #获取对象p的
阅读全文
posted @ 2019-12-04 22:02 手可摘星辰。
阅读(223)
评论(0)
推荐(0)
2019年12月2日
python_面向对象——属性方法property
摘要: 1.属性方法 class Student(object): def __init__(self,name): self.name = name @property #属性方法:把一个方法变成一个静态的属性或者变量。 def fly(self): print('{} fly...'.format(se
阅读全文
posted @ 2019-12-02 14:00 手可摘星辰。
阅读(236)
评论(0)
推荐(0)
2019年11月29日
python_面向对象——类方法和静态方法
摘要: 1.类方法不能访问实例变量,只能访问类变量。 class Dog(object): name = 'wdc' def __init__(self,name): self.name = name def eat(self): #普通方法 print(self) print('{}在吃东西~'.form
阅读全文
posted @ 2019-11-29 13:11 手可摘星辰。
阅读(284)
评论(0)
推荐(0)
2019年11月24日
python_面向对象——编程步骤
摘要: 校园管理系统: 设计一个学校机构管理系统,有总部、分校、有学院、老师、员工,实现具体如下需求: 1.有多个课程,课程要有定价 2.有多个班级,班级跟课程有关联 3.有多个学生,学生报名班级,交这个班级对应的课程的费用 4.有多个老师,可以分布在不同校区,上不同本机的课 5.有多个员工,可以分布在不同
阅读全文
posted @ 2019-11-24 16:45 手可摘星辰。
阅读(208)
评论(0)
推荐(0)
2019年11月21日
python_面向对象——多态
摘要: 1.同一接口,多种形态 class Document: def __init__(self,name): self.name = name def show(self): # 异常处理:提示子类必须把此方法重新写一遍 raise NotADirectoryError('子类必须把此方法重新写一遍')
阅读全文
posted @ 2019-11-21 13:58 手可摘星辰。
阅读(114)
评论(0)
推荐(0)
2019年11月20日
python_面向对象——封装
摘要: 1.私有属性 class Person(object): def __init__(self,name,age): self.name = name self.age = age #实例属性 self.attack_val = 30 self.__life_val = 100 #前面加两个下划线就是
阅读全文
posted @ 2019-11-20 09:03 手可摘星辰。
阅读(190)
评论(0)
推荐(0)
上一页
1
···
14
15
16
17
18
19
20
21
22
···
26
下一页
公告